Natural Disaster Recovery Grant

  1. Home

Thu, 08/08/2024 - 4:09pm by laughingcat

According to the National Weather Service, Indiana averages 22 tornadoes per year. As a country, we average 1,402 per year, but as of July 17, we have already had more than 1,421. With extreme weather events like this expected to increase, our urban tree canopy will likely continue to be negatively affected.

To help communities recover some of their tree canopy from past extreme weather events and plan for future events, the DNR CUF program has developed a grant program specifically for these efforts. Communities that have had their tree canopy impacted by natural disasters and would like to plant trees in the affected area and get help planning for future events may now apply for funding through our Natural Disaster Recovery (NDR) Grant.
